if you're going to replace the LCA's the just block the engine and drop the subframe. it's a little extra work but IMO will make things lots easier in the long run. i tried the jacking the tranny thing for the clearence i've so much talk about and i could never get enough clearence on the front drivers side bolt to get it out. i'm just thinking that if you re-install the bolts for the LCA upside down and Murphy's law come knocking (like it seems to happen with these cars) and the nut backs off for what ever reason your bolt is gone. however if it's put back in through the top then it shouldn't be able to go anywhere. this is just me. also i had no top to bottom play in my wheel bearing which is weird to me. and no hum just a little vibration at highway speeds and side to side play. good luck.
